Output eca61140b7d53c85648a7896740f4fbd02754c5113524adc62a90734c6ce763a:0

value
7270
script pubkey
OP_0 OP_PUSHBYTES_20 2f851377a294ed816e84320840f41c67a82ed4c1
address
bc1q97z3xaazjnkczm5yxgyypaquv75za4xpnkj34k
transaction
eca61140b7d53c85648a7896740f4fbd02754c5113524adc62a90734c6ce763a
spent
true